JOBS LAW ENTERS DECISIVE BATTLE IN CONSTITUTIONAL COURT
After a long road, President Joko “Jokowi” Widodo finally enacted the Job Creation Law as Law
No. 11/2020. The law is seen as a masterpiece of Jokowi’s government in his second term, a
fulfillment of his campaign promises and a form of regulatory review of the complex licensing
and bureaucracy that has hindered economic growth.
However, the State Secretariat slipped in the final stage: the harmonization and synchronization
of the provisions contained in the law. There appears to be a typo error in Article 6, which refers
to Article 5 paragraph (1), while Article 5 stands alone and has no paragraph. Therefore, State
Secretary Pratikno told the media the incident was an administrative technical error.
In soccer, such an error is akin to a mistake committed inside the penalty box in a crucial moment
that defines a quality striker. Dutch soccer legend Johan Cruyff was correct when he said,
“Football is a game of mistakes, whoever makes the fewest mistakes wins”. As in soccer, the
harmonization process of the omnibus law demands perfection.
Inaccuracy in synchronization and harmonization has only exacerbated the polemic that has
plagued the legislation from the beginning. The error reflects poor quality of the government’s
lawmaking capacity.
